BSP
有招-康禾-曌暖
这个作者很懒,什么都没留下…
展开
-
STM32_I2C总线
#I2C总线介绍1、 I2C(Inter-Integrated Circuit)总线是一种由PHILIPS公司在80年代开发的两线式串行总线,用于连接微控制器及其外围设备。I2C总线最主要的优点是其简单性和有效性。由于接口直接在组件之上,因此I2C总线占用的空间非常小,减少了电路板的空间和芯片管脚的数量,降低了互联成本。总线的长度可高达25英尺,并且能够以10Kbps的最大传输速率支持40个组件...原创 2019-10-13 18:27:30 · 41 阅读 · 0 评论 -
定时器-CP采样
充电桩-CP电压模拟量采集、发波原创 2023-06-04 22:49:34 · 17 阅读 · 0 评论 -
GD芯片替换ST芯片ADC采集异常现象
欧标大桩-主板用GD32F103VET6芯片替换原来ST32F103VET6的片子,在芯片的替换过程中,旧板子上做的驱动跟功能性测试,均正常,新板子上测试时发现采集的ADC数据出现异常,本文档是基于采集ADC数据异常做的解决方案原创 2023-06-11 00:08:44 · 12 阅读 · 0 评论 -
BSP-I2C-EEprom-AT24LC512T
EEprom原创 2022-06-05 20:50:30 · 219 阅读 · 0 评论 -
BSP-flash
主要介绍mcu-内部flash1、STM32F207VET6跟GD32F407VET6,flash的结构:包含4个16KB的扇区、1个64KB的扇区、3个128KB的扇区。块0跟块1。内部flash的起始地址:0x08000000。擦除单位:扇区。写入:字节,半字,字和双字写入。写FLASH的时候,如果发现写入地址的FLASH没有被擦除,数据将不会写入。读:可以按寻址方式读取。...原创 2021-10-31 22:57:36 · 180 阅读 · 0 评论 -
BSP-定时器
1.定时器GD32F407vet6,常用的定时器通用1~4,基本5/6,高级0/7。用过的功能,主从模式控制器,通道配置为可编程的PWM模式,普通的作为系统时钟用的。模式1:基本定时功能程序:`void TIM1_Init(u16 arr,u16 psc) { TIM_TimeBaseInitTypeDef TIM_TimeBaseStructure; NVIC_InitTypeDef NVIC_InitStructure; RCC_APB2PeriphClockCmd(RCC原创 2021-10-30 23:48:51 · 184 阅读 · 0 评论 -
GD407替代ST207-硬件I2C+DMA收发
GD407替代ST207,硬件I2C+dma收发;目前存在问题:1、发送数据时,从机收不到地址。采用硬件I2C加dma的收发,有利于程序的实时性,不会出现明显的延迟。/****************************************I2C配置 dma配置 中间层数据配置******************************************************/I2C配置程序如下:_BSPStatus_TypeDef BSP_Driver_Init(void){原创 2021-10-23 16:03:26 · 558 阅读 · 0 评论 -
gd407替换st207采用st库-串口空闲中断+dma收发
st采用串口3-dma收发,串口空闲中断,用来读写计量芯片RN8209DGPIO配置: void GPIO_CFG(COM_TypeDef Com){ GPIO_InitTypeDef GPIO_InitStructure; RCC_AHB1PeriphClockCmd( COM_TX_PORT_CLK[Com] | COM_RX_PORT_CLK[Com], ENABLE); GPIO_InitStructure.GPIO_Pin = COM_TX_PIN[Com]; GPIO_原创 2021-10-19 16:31:47 · 325 阅读 · 0 评论 -
gd407-adc-dma
时间:2021-10-04简述:芯片GD32F407VET6,用了3个adc,其中adc0跟2规则通道,adc1注入通道;规则通道采用dma接受,都是用的定时器外部触发;原创 2021-10-04 23:44:51 · 7 阅读 · 0 评论 -
GPIO配置
stm32f2071、List配置**#define GPIO_MODE_INPUT 0x00000000U /*!< Input Floating Mode 输入浮动模式 */#define GPIO_MODE_OUTPUT_PP 0x00000001U /*!< Output Push Pull Mode 推挽输出模式 */原创 2021-09-11 18:20:10 · 12 阅读 · 0 评论